mes3.quanyou.com.cn
时间: 2023-06-14 11:02:01 浏览: 54
mes3.quanyou.com.cn是中国广东省肇庆市建设机械有限公司(简称“广建机械”)的MES系统网站。MES是制造业执行层面的管理信息系统,通过获取工厂生产数据的实时信息,对整个生产过程进行监控与管理,从而保证生产效率和产品质量。广建机械作为一家专注于建筑机械和道路机械生产和销售的企业,将其MES系统与生产线、仓库、采购等环节有效结合,实现了生产过程的实时监控和控制,提高了生产效率和产品质量,增强了企业竞争力。广建机械关注产品品质,加强管理水平,提高生产效率,积极推动智能化制造,为客户提供更好的产品和服务。
相关问题
mes.encode()
### 回答1:
这段代码看起来像是Python语言中的某个对象(`mes`)的一个方法调用(`encode()`)。然而,没有上下文或更多信息,我无法确定这段代码的确切含义。
一般来说,`encode()` 方法用于将字符串转换为字节序列,以便在网络传输或持久化存储等场景中使用。例如,以下是一个将字符串编码为UTF-8字节序列的示例:
```python
message = "Hello, world!"
encoded_message = message.encode("utf-8")
print(encoded_message)
```
输出结果为:
```
b'Hello, world!'
```
注意,在这个例子中,`encode()` 方法返回一个字节串对象,前面有一个 `b` 前缀,表示这是一个字节串而不是字符串。
### 回答2:
在Python中,`mes.encode()`是一个字符串方法,它用于将字符串转换为指定的编码格式。该方法主要用于将Unicode字符串转换为其他编码,例如UTF-8。实际上,`encode()`方法的作用是将一个字符串转换为字节序列,以便在计算机和网络之间进行传输和存储。
该方法的一般形式是`mes.encode(encoding='编码格式', errors='错误处理方式')`。其中,`encoding`参数用于指定要使用的编码格式,默认值为UTF-8。常见的编码格式还包括ASCII、ISO-8859-1和UTF-16等。`errors`参数用于指定处理编码错误的方式,默认为`strict`,表示遇到错误时抛出`UnicodeEncodeError`异常。其他常见的错误处理方式还包括`ignore`(忽略错误)、`replace`(用指定的占位符代替错误字符)、`xmlcharrefreplace`(用对应的XML字符实体替代错误字符)等。
例如,如果有一个Unicode字符串`message = '你好,世界'`,我们可以使用`mes.encode("UTF-8")`将其转换为UTF-8编码的字节序列。这样,我们就可以将字节序列写入文件、通过网络传输或存储到数据库等操作。
需要注意的是,`encode()`方法只能用于字符串类型(str),如果尝试对其他类型的对象调用该方法,将会引发`AttributeError`异常。此外,虽然`encode()`将字符串转换为字节序列,但不能将字节序列转换回字符串,转换回字符串需要使用`decode()`方法。
### 回答3:
mes.encode()是Python中的字符串方法,用于将字符串转换为字节类型。在Python中,字符串是以Unicode编码进行存储和处理的,而字节类型是以字节为单位进行存储的。mes.encode()方法会根据默认的编码格式将字符串转换为字节类型。
在调用mes.encode()方法时,如果没有指定编码格式,默认使用UTF-8编码格式。UTF-8是一种常用的Unicode字符编码方式,可以表示几乎所有的字符,包括中文、英文、数字等。对于包含中文字符的字符串,使用UTF-8编码可以保证正确地将字符串转换为字节。
调用mes.encode()方法后,会返回一个字节类型的对象,可以将其赋值给一个变量,或者直接进行操作。可以使用编码后的字节进行数据传输、存储或其他处理。需要注意的是,在进行数据传输或存储时,需要保证接收方能正确地解码字节为对应的字符串。如果接收方使用的是不同的编码格式,则需要使用对应的解码方法进行解码。
总之,mes.encode()是将字符串转换为字节类型的方法,可以使用默认编码格式或指定编码格式进行转换。这个方法在实际开发中特别在涉及到字符串的网络传输和文件IO操作中有着广泛的应用。
@MapperScan("{com.million.mes.basic.dbapi.common.dao,com.million.mes.basic.dbapi.common.modelpagedao}")
这是一个MyBatis的注解,用于扫描指定的包下面的Mapper接口,将其注册到Spring容器中。其中,@MapperScan注解中的参数是一个字符串数组,用于指定要扫描的包路径。在这个例子中,要扫描的包路径是"com.million.mes.basic.dbapi.common.dao"和"com.million.mes.basic.dbapi.common.modelpagedao"。这样做的目的是为了让这些Mapper接口能够被自动注入到需要使用它们的地方,例如Service层或Controller层。